Jaw crushers are in various sizes and performance levels because the jaw crusher size will be described by the gape and width which is expressed as gape * width. The jaw crusher have the different kinds of part to reduce the size of stone such as a flywheel, eccentric shaft, cheek plate, jaw plates, wedge, toggle plates, and frame

Feb 17, 2016 A jaw crusher has a wider range of settings—generally, a maximum of two to three times the smallest setting. The tables also show that for a comparable maximum size of feed and setting, a gyratory crusher has a much greater capacity than a jaw crusher

May 06, 2021 A jaw crusher size is obtained by looking at its feed opening (gape) and length. As an example, a monster 7959 of 79″ x 59″ (2m x 1.5m) will have its fixed jaws 79″ apart where the feed enters on a 59″ wide set of liner plates. Crushers are machines used to reduce the size of rocks, stones and ore. They are often utilized in aggregates production, construction material recycling and in mining operations. Jaw Crushers 7 The BB 50 is designed for a very efficient and convenient size reduction pro-cess. The variable speed can be set between 550 and 950 min-1 to adapt the crushing process to sample requirements. The possibility to reverse the rotat- ing direction is helpful if too much sample material has been fed to the crusher causing it to block
